I know this has been asked before...kinda. I just want to clarify though before I invest in the resources.

A)Control Units and PowerConditioners -DO have a quality componant so experimentation affects final product

B) Gp Moduals, Electronics Memory Moduals, Energy Distributers and micro Sensor Suites -DON'T have a quality componant so experimentation is pointless

Is that right? Or will the items under B affect the outcome of Droid eng's and Architect's products if they also arn't up to scratch.

I asked some architects and Droid Engineers and another master artisan and didn't get any clear answers.

Any clarification would be apreciated

The simple answer is that it depends on the item you are making.


Vehicle Customisation Kits don't care what the components are like, it works just off the stats of the resources used in the final combine, but crafting stations do care about the quality of the components.
